  • Definition of artificial intelligence:

Artificial intelligence works by combining large amounts of data with rapid, iterative processing as well as intelligent algorithms that allow software to learn and automatically recognize patterns.The goal of artificial intelligence is to create systems that can work intelligently and independently of humans, and perform tasks in professional fields such as building construction or automated factories by intelligent robots.

Step 1: Identify business needs and opportunities

The first step to leveraging AI is to accurately understand the needs and opportunities in your business. This step requires a deep dive into your organizational processes, challenges, and goals. Are you experiencing delays in your supply chain? Is your customer service department struggling to handle the high volume of requests? Or perhaps you are looking for ways to attract new customers through targeted marketing?To start, hold meetings with different teams to identify weaknesses and areas for improvement. For example, a logistics company may find that its shipping routes are not optimal, which leads to additional costs. Here, AI algorithms can suggest optimal routes and reduce costs.It’s important to set specific, measurable, and realistic goals. Instead of a vague goal like “increase sales,” set a goal like “increase online sales through AI recommender systems by 15% in three months.” These goals will help you keep your AI projects focused and results-oriented.

Step 2: Collect and prepare data

AI without quality data is like a car without fuel. Data is the foundation of AI models, and its quality directly impacts the success of your projects. At this stage, you need to identify your data sources and ensure they are suitable for use in AI.

First, examine the data available in your organization: sales records, customer information, website data, internal reports, or even data generated by IoT devices.Next, assess the quality of this data. Is the data complete and accurate? Are there any inconsistencies, such as missing values ​​or non-standard formats? The data cleansing process, which involves removing errors, filling gaps, and integrating data, is critical at this stage.

Example:

If you own an online store, AI can analyze your customers’ purchase history to identify buying patterns and predict which products will be popular in the future. This can help you manage your inventory optimally and adjust your marketing strategies according to your customers’ needs.

Step 3: Reduce costs and optimize processes

Artificial intelligence can help businesses automate many processes, thereby reducing operational costs. This is especially important in industries such as manufacturing, logistics, and customer service. With the use of artificial intelligence, many repetitive and time-consuming tasks can be automated, and employees can focus more on strategic tasks.

Example in the manufacturing industry:

In manufacturing industries, AI can be used to predict machine failures and plan maintenance. These predictions can help you make necessary repairs before serious problems occur and avoid additional costs caused by sudden production stops.

Step 4: Implement and test AI projects

Once you have chosen the tools, it is time to implement your AI projects. This phase involves developing models, integrating them with existing systems, and testing their performance. It is best to start with small, low-risk projects to gain experience and avoid costly mistakes.

For example, an insurance company might first implement an AI system to automate claims review. This system can process simple claims more quickly and reduce staff workload. Once implemented, evaluate the system’s performance using metrics such as accuracy, speed, and customer satisfaction.

Continuous testing and optimization are essential at this stage. AI models often require additional tuning to achieve the best performance. User feedback and performance data will help you identify and fix problems. Also, make sure that AI systems are well integrated with existing software, such as customer relationship management (CRM) or en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ems.

Step 5: Human resource management and improving employee efficiency

In human resources, AI can help businesses improve their hiring and performance evaluation processes. AI systems can analyze resumes and identify suitable candidates. They can also track employee performance trends and help managers make decisions about promotions and performance improvements.

Smart hiring:

Using AI systems, you can automatically review incoming resumes and select the best candidates from thousands of applications. This can make the hiring process faster, more accurate, and less expensive.

With all the benefits of AI, its adoption in businesses also comes with challenges. High implementation costs, a shortage of skilled manpower, and concerns about privacy and security are among the issues that need to be addressed.

1.High initial costs: Implementing AI requires a large initial investment. However, in the long run, it can help reduce costs and increase profits.

2.Skill shortage: The supply of skilled manpower in the field of AI is still limited in many markets.

3.Ethical concerns: The use of AI in important decision-making may raise concerns about algorithmic bias and privacy violations.

Personalizing the customer experience with AI

One of the most powerful applications of AI is its ability to deliver personalized experiences to customers. In a world where customers expect services tailored to their needs, AI can analyze customer data and provide recommendations that are precisely aligned with their interests and behavior.

For example, e-commerce platforms like Amazon use AI to recommend products based on purchase history, searches, and even time spent on pages. This level of personalization not only increases customer satisfaction, but also improves conversion rates and loyalty.

Smaller businesses can also benefit from this approach. A local coffee shop could use AI to analyze customer data and provide personalized offers, such as discounts on a customer’s favorite coffee. Tools like intelligent chatbots can also provide 24/7 interactions with customers, creating a seamless experience.

Predicting and managing risk with AI

Artificial intelligence can help businesses predict and manage operational, financial, and even security risks. Using machine learning algorithms, AI can identify unusual patterns in data and warn before problems occur.

For example, in the financial industry, banks are using AI to detect fraud. These systems analyze transactions in real time and identify suspicious activity, such as unusual withdrawals from an account. In manufacturing, AI can examine sensor data to predict equipment failure and prevent production line downtime.

Small businesses can also benefit from this capability. A shipping company could use AI to predict potential delivery delays due to weather or traffic conditions and plan better. This approach not only reduces costs but also increases customer trust.
